Polish writer charged for calling president a 'moron'

A Polish writer faces a possible prison sentence for insulting President Andrzej Duda by calling him a “moron” over comments the latter made about Joe Biden’s US election victory.

Jakub Żulczyk, the screenwrit­er behind the popular TV series Blinded by the Lights and Belfer, said prosecutor­s had charged him under an article in the criminal code for insulting the head of state in a Facebook post.

“I am, I suspect, the first writer in this country in a very long time to be tried for what he wrote,” he said on Facebook.

In his post on 7 November last year, Żulczyk commented on a curiously worded tweet in which Duda congratula­ted Biden for his “successful presidenti­al campaign” but said he was waiting for “the nomination by the electoral college”.

Duda, who is supported by the populist rightwing Law and Justice (Pis) party, was a close ally of Biden’s predecesso­r, Donald Trump, who unsuccessf­ully contested the election result.

Aleksandra Skrzyniarz, a spokeswoma­n for Warsaw district prosecutor­s, told Polish news agency PAP on Monday that charges had been filed against a man, naming him only as “Jakub Z”.

“The defendant was accused of committing an act of public insult on 7 November last year on a social networking website against the president of the Republic of Poland, by using a term commonly recognised as insulting,” the spokeswoma­n said.

She added that the charge had been filed earlier this month and that the suspect had been questioned but “did not admit to committing the alleged act and gave explanatio­ns”.

“He indicated that the statement constitute­d a critical assessment of the president’s actions,” she said.

In his post, published in the days immediatel­y after the 3 November election, Żulczyk said that “there is no such thing as ’nomination by the electoral college’”, adding that Biden’s confirmati­on as US president was “a mere formality”.

“Andrzej Duda is a moron”, the post said.

Poland has been criticised repeatedly over its different insult laws, including one law on offending religious feeling and another on insulting the flags of Poland or other countries.
